The project focused on embodiment as an innovative approach in non-formal education, working with bodily awareness, emotions, and lived experience. Participants explored how connecting body and mind can foster creativity, inclusion, self-reflection, and active citizenship among young people. The programme responded to the challenges of today’s fast-paced and highly digitalised world, in which many young people experience stress, disconnection from themselves, and difficulties in understanding their own emotions and needs.
During the project, participants tried out somatic exercises, movement-based activities, and other experiential methods grounded in the principles of non-formal learning. Goosebumps offered practical tools that help people reconnect with themselves, build resilience, and strengthen a sense of personal competence. At the same time, it showed that working with the body can be a gentle yet powerful tool for change – and that non-verbal and inclusive forms of learning can be accessible to diverse target groups.
